On 9.7.2021 0.18, José Roberto de Souza wrote:
> Same bit was required for Wa_14012131227 in DG1 now it is also
> required as Wa_1508744258 to TGL, RKL, DG1, ADL-S and ADL-P.
> 
> Cc: Gwan-gyeong Mun <gwan-gyeong.mun@intel.com>
> Signed-off-by: José Roberto de Souza <jose.souza@intel.com>
> ---
>   dr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/intel_workarounds.c | 7 +++++++
>   1 file changed, 7 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/intel_workarounds.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/intel_workarounds.c
> index e5e3f820074a9..c346229e2be00 100644
>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/intel_workarounds.c
>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/intel_workarounds.c
> @@ -670,6 +670,13 @@ static void gen12_ctx_workarounds_init(struct intel_engine_cs *engine,
>   	       FF_MODE2_GS_TIMER_MASK,
>   	       FF_MODE2_GS_TIMER_224,
>   	       0);
> +
> +	/*
> +	 * Wa_14012131227:dg1
> +	 * Wa_1508744258:tgl,rkl,dg1,adl-s,adl-p
> +	 */
> +	wa_masked_en(wal, GEN7_COMMON_SLICE_CHICKEN1,
> +		     GEN9_RHWO_OPTIMIZATION_DISABLE);
>   }
>   
>   static void dg1_ctx_workarounds_init(struct intel_engine_cs *engine,
> 

Hi, I don't see this (or patches 3, 4) in drm-intel-next, are they not 
needed anymore?
